Abstract

A kind of seal with annular groove muscle structure of automobile engine gasket seal, its seal with annular groove muscle assumes diamond in shape network distribution, and each side in the middle of it is respectively connected together, is trapped among around the cylinder of gasket seal mouthful;The section of its seal with annular groove muscle is into triangle sharp edge type shape.The sharp basil degree of its seal with annular groove muscle is between the o of 120 o~150.Advantage is, possess good sealing effectiveness, the generation of the bad phenomenon can be avoided as far as possible, and production cost is low, safe and reliable and use occasion is flexible, it can be used for relatively low closed with high field of pressure, be suitable for the automobile engine of most models on the market.

Background technology
Car engine secret cylinder pad is located between cylinder head and cylinder block, its act on be fill up cylinder head and cylinder block it Between microscopic void, it is ensured that there is good sealing at faying face, and then combustion chamber is remained absolute closing, The phenomenon of cylinder leakage tester, oil leak and water jacket leak can be avoided to occur, with continually strengthening for automobile engine, thermic load and machinery Load is continuously increased, and the sealing property for improving gasket seal is particularly important.And to the requirement of gasket seal sealing property most High position is the sealed muscle around cylinder mouthful, and sealed muscle subjects more than 70% thermic load and mechanical load, Gu Gangkou at this The quality of sealed muscle will directly affect the normal operation of engine.
Common gasket seal mainly has metallic packing, asbestos seal gasket, without asbestos seal pad on the market at present Piece, because asbestos seal gasket has certain toxicity, causes the proportion of its occuping market share fewer and fewer, and close without asbestos Gasket high temperature resistant and it is corrosion-resistant in terms of not as the effect of metallic packing it is good, so in engine field of sealing technology, Proportion shared by metallic packing is increasing, but each model automobile engine uses metallic packing at present, according to So it there is the bad phenomenons such as cylinder leakage tester, oil leak and water jacket leak, therefore the not good enough serious restriction of gasket seal quality The development of Engine Industry.
The content of the invention
The purpose of this utility model is to solve that above-mentioned the problems of existing there is provided a kind of preferable vapour of sealing property The seal with annular groove muscle structure of car engine gasket seal.
The technical solution adopted in the utility model is:Its seal with annular groove muscle assumes diamond in shape network distribution, every in the middle of it Individual side is respectively connected together, and is trapped among around the cylinder of gasket seal mouthful;The section of its seal with annular groove muscle is into triangle sharp edge type shape.
The sharp basil degree of its seal with annular groove muscle is between the o of 120 o~150.
During individual layer gasket seal, the seal with annular groove muscle in the end edge of rhombus two is in opposite direction, the cylinder mouthful on middle each side Sealed muscle direction is consistent;During double-layer seal pad, the seal with annular groove muscle direction on every layer of gasket seal is consistent.
The utility model has the advantages that, the sealed muscle at cylinder mouthful is carried out to the distribution of network battle array structure, can started During machine normal work, it is uniformly distributed born mechanical load, thermic load etc., it is to avoid stress is concentrated, to rush cylinder etc. bad Seal with annular groove muscle in the generation of phenomenon, the end edge of rhombus two can be close according to actual conditions, i.e. individual layer gasket seal or double-deck pad Envelope, the adjustment of travel direction, during individual layer gasket seal, because pressure is relatively low, network battle array is equivalent to making seal with annular groove Muscle carries out the sealing of the sharp sword muscle of individual layer, and in the higher double-deck gasket seal of pressure, and now network battle array is equivalent to making cylinder Mouth sealed muscle carries out the sealing of double-deck sharp sword muscle, makes it the environment preferably suitable for supercharging, i.e. the utility model uses field Composition and division in a proportion is more flexible, can with workplace the need for its structure is changed accordingly, in addition, in the middle of rhombus on each side Seal with annular groove muscle can play a part of the end edge upper cylinder half mouthful sealed muscle of support protection rhombus two, make the seal with annular groove muscle in two end edges When engine works, it is to avoid situation about failing occur.
Its section concrete structure of seal with annular groove muscle is triangle sharp edge type, and the linear sealing to cylinder system can be achieved, And the seal form can farthest be sealed to combustion gas, cooling water, machine oil, the hair of leakage phenomenon can be effectively prevented from It is raw.
At present, metallic packing is as the gasket seal being most widely used in engine field of sealing technology, therefore close to its The research of sealing property is significant, and the utility model is easily let out summarizing current gasket seal existing on the market It is designed after the bad phenomenons such as dew, damage cylinder, by practice test, the utility model possesses good sealing effect Really, the generation of the bad phenomenon can be avoided as far as possible, and production cost is low, safe and reliable and use occasion is flexible, It can be used for relatively low closed with high field of pressure, be suitable for the automobile engine of most models on the market, and this is close Gasket has very strong epitaxy, is not only widely applied in automobile engine field of sealing technology, and expansible extension To other sealed fields of needs such as space flight and aviation, ship and lifes staying idle at home, therefore belong to preferably practical example, with certain popularization Value.

Embodiment
Describe in detail below in conjunction with the accompanying drawings:As illustrated, its seal with annular groove muscle assumes diamond in shape, network is distributed, in the middle of it Each side is respectively connected together, and is trapped among around the cylinder of gasket seal mouthful;The section of its seal with annular groove muscle 1 is into triangle sharp edge type Shape.
The sharp basil degree a of its seal with annular groove muscle 1 is between the o of 120 o~150.
During individual layer gasket seal, the seal with annular groove muscle 1 in the end edge of rhombus two is in opposite direction, the cylinder mouthful on middle each side The direction of sealed muscle 1 is consistent;During double-layer seal pad, the direction of seal with annular groove muscle 1 on every layer of gasket seal is consistent.
When automobile engine is in normal work, gasket seal is under the multiple action of thermic load and mechanical load In one HTHP and perishable dynamic environment, wherein, gasket seal is subject at cylinder mouth from engine more than 70% Load, now the load that cylinder system can be brought of structure distribution of seal with annular groove muscle network battle array divide equally and be distributed, Not only make seal with annular groove muscle keep closely contacting with cylinder system time, and be less prone to stress concentration, damage The situation of cylinder, can finally realize the absolute static seal under dynamic operation condition.
